    Jorge> Talking about figures, what's the correct way of using
    Jorge> figures when the desired output will be published on-line
    Jorge> and in a book?

I always had my Makefile run "convert" (or other scripts) to make sure
that there was always a .gif (should probably be .png) and a .eps
file, at which point I did not put the extension in my "fileref"
attribute.  It works reasonably.

    Jorge> Do I need to have pictures in EPS (or PS) format and in
    Jorge> another (e.g. JPEG) format? Isn't there a way of using only
    Jorge> one graphical format for all outputs? EPS pictures are
    Jorge> _really_ BIG.

If you use pdf output, it should be able to handle .jpg directly, but
I have not played with this much.  Anyone else?
